JUNK REMOVAL PRICING

A useful estimate starts with a clear picture of the work.

Junk removal cost in Spokane depends on loaded volume, material weight, access, labor, and disposal requirements.

PLAN THE PROJECT

What to know before the truck arrives.

Volume

Truck space is a major pricing factor. A compact furniture pickup differs from a multi-room property cleanout.

Access and labor

Stairs, elevators, long carrying distance, disassembly, and difficult access can change the time and crew needs.

Material and handling

Dense debris, special disposal needs, and oversized items can affect the estimate even when the load looks small.

What to send

List the items, approximate quantity, ZIP code, pickup location, access notes, and preferred timing. Photos can help when available during follow-up.

QUESTIONS BEFORE YOU BOOK

A clearer request leads to a smoother pickup.

Is the estimate the final price?

The final scope should be confirmed before removal begins. Changes in volume, access, or material can change the work.

What should an estimate include?

Ask what is included for labor, loading, hauling, disposal, and the final work-area sweep.

Can I request pricing for a whole cleanout?

Yes. Break the project down by room or area and describe the largest or heaviest items.
